Venezuela local elections: great turnout and divided victories  by rahul

The first official results of Venezuela's state and municipal elections has just been issued by Tibisay Lucena, the president of the National Electoral Council. After counting over 60 % counting of electoral juntas of the votes, results did not show a clear victory for the ChavezĀ“s candidates in meaningful posts. The opposition won at traditional opposition place of Zulia But also regain control over Miranda state and Caracas Mayoral post. The opposition came divided to the elections an suffer major set backs in the following states Aragua, Barinas, Anzoategui, Bolivar, Cojedes, Yaracuy, Falcon, Guarico, Trujillo, Lara, Sucre. Turnout - over 65,49% of the electorate universe -was rather high for local election historical standards in Venezuela. This turnout shows the renewed interest and enthusiasm on politics. In addition it demonstrated the trust of Venezuelans over their electoral systems. International observers have also hailed the technical facilities and flawless outcome of the elections.     As President Chavez took it to heart to win this elections, their result are to be interpreted as a lukewarm sign for the extension of his tenure in power beyond 2013. Chavez would now need to devote much energy to oppose hostile opponents at the local level and within his own party. The world financial crisis and deficient management of his policies could create havoc in the near future. It is up to his administration to govern with less money and more focused social aims. The opposition would now need to analyse defeat and envision the more democratic selection of its candidates. Unlike the governing PSUV, the opposition parties did not celebrate internal elections to choose their candidates; on the contrary. they appointed candidates by manoeuvring politics, internal struggles and negotiations among few leaders.
